Home
Courses
Knowledge Base
Register
Login
✕
What do you whant to learn?
Search
Robot Programming & Software
ROS & ROS2 (packages, nodes, architecture, tools)
Robot Actuators and Motors 101
Selecting Motors and Gearboxes for Robots
Actuators: Harmonic Drives, Cycloidal, Direct Drive
Motor Sizing for Robots: From Requirements to Selection
BLDC Control in Practice: FOC, Hall vs Encoder, Tuning
Harmonic vs Cycloidal vs Direct Drive: Choosing Actuators
Understanding Servo and Stepper Motors in Robotics
Hydraulic and Pneumatic Actuation in Heavy Robots
Thermal Modeling and Cooling Strategies for High-Torque Actuators
Inside Servo Motor Control: Encoders, Drivers, and Feedback Loops
Stepper Motors: Simplicity and Precision in Motion
Hydraulic and Electric Actuators: Trade-offs in Robotic Design
Programming Languages (Python, C++, specialized DSLs)
Power Systems in Mobile Robots
Robot Power Systems and Energy Management
Designing Energy-Efficient Robots
Energy Management: Battery Choices for Mobile Robots
Battery Technologies for Mobile Robots
Battery Chemistries for Mobile Robots: LFP, NMC, LCO, Li-ion Alternatives
BMS for Robotics: Protection, SOX Estimation, Telemetry
Fast Charging and Swapping for Robot Fleets
Power Budgeting & Distribution in Robots
Designing Efficient Power Systems for Mobile Robots
Energy Recovery and Regenerative Braking in Robotics
Designing Safe Power Isolation and Emergency Cutoff Systems
Battery Management and Thermal Safety in Robotics
Power Distribution Architectures for Multi-Module Robots
Wireless and Contactless Charging for Autonomous Robots
Simulation Platforms (Gazebo, Isaac Sim, Webots, PyBullet, MuJoCo)
Mechanical Components of Robotic Arms
Mechanical Design of Robot Joints and Frames
Soft Robotics: Materials and Actuation
Robot Joints, Materials, and Longevity
Soft Robotics: Materials and Actuation
Mechanical Design: Lightweight vs Stiffness
Thermal Management for Compact Robots
Environmental Protection: IP Ratings, Sealing, and EMC/EMI
Wiring Harnesses & Connectors for Robots
Lightweight Structural Materials in Robot Design
Joint and Linkage Design for Precision Motion
Structural Vibration Damping in Lightweight Robots
Lightweight Alloys and Composites for Robot Frames
Joint Design and Bearing Selection for High Precision
Modular Robot Structures: Designing for Scalability and Repairability
Behavior Trees & State Machines (task orchestration)
End Effectors: The Hands of Robots
End Effectors: Choosing the Right Tool
End Effectors: Designing Robot Hands and Tools
Robot Grippers: Design and Selection
End Effectors for Logistics and E-commerce
End Effectors and Tool Changers: Designing for Quick Re-Tooling
Designing Custom End Effectors for Complex Tasks
Tool Changers and Quick-Swap Systems for Robotics
Soft Grippers: Safe Interaction for Fragile Objects
Vacuum and Magnetic End Effectors: Industrial Applications
Adaptive Grippers and AI-Controlled Manipulation
Robot Middleware (communication frameworks, message protocols)
Robot Computing Hardware
Cloud Robotics and Edge Computing
Computing Hardware for Edge AI Robots
AI Hardware Acceleration for Robotics
Embedded GPUs for Edge Robotics
Edge AI Deployment: Quantization and Pruning
Embedded Computing Boards for Robotics
Ruggedizing Compute for the Edge: GPUs, IPCs, SBCs
Time-Sensitive Networking (TSN) and Deterministic Ethernet
Embedded Computing for Real-Time Robotics
Edge AI Hardware: GPUs, FPGAs, and NPUs
FPGA-Based Real-Time Vision Processing for Robots
Real-Time Computing on Edge Devices for Robotics
GPU Acceleration in Robotics Vision and Simulation
FPGA Acceleration for Low-Latency Control Loops
Robot Hardware 101: Motors, Actuators, and Power Systems
Main
Robot Programming & Software
Category - Robot Programming & Software
Articles
Robot Hardware 101: Motors, Actuators, and Power Systems
Sub Categories
ROS & ROS2 (packages, nodes, architecture, tools)
Robot Actuators and Motors 101
Selecting Motors and Gearboxes for Robots
Actuators: Harmonic Drives, Cycloidal, Direct Drive
Motor Sizing for Robots: From Requirements to Selection
BLDC Control in Practice: FOC, Hall vs Encoder, Tuning
Harmonic vs Cycloidal vs Direct Drive: Choosing Actuators
Understanding Servo and Stepper Motors in Robotics
Hydraulic and Pneumatic Actuation in Heavy Robots
Thermal Modeling and Cooling Strategies for High-Torque Actuators
Inside Servo Motor Control: Encoders, Drivers, and Feedback Loops
Stepper Motors: Simplicity and Precision in Motion
Hydraulic and Electric Actuators: Trade-offs in Robotic Design
Programming Languages (Python, C++, specialized DSLs)
Power Systems in Mobile Robots
Robot Power Systems and Energy Management
Designing Energy-Efficient Robots
Energy Management: Battery Choices for Mobile Robots
Battery Technologies for Mobile Robots
Battery Chemistries for Mobile Robots: LFP, NMC, LCO, Li-ion Alternatives
BMS for Robotics: Protection, SOX Estimation, Telemetry
Fast Charging and Swapping for Robot Fleets
Power Budgeting & Distribution in Robots
Designing Efficient Power Systems for Mobile Robots
Energy Recovery and Regenerative Braking in Robotics
Designing Safe Power Isolation and Emergency Cutoff Systems
Battery Management and Thermal Safety in Robotics
Power Distribution Architectures for Multi-Module Robots
Wireless and Contactless Charging for Autonomous Robots
Simulation Platforms (Gazebo, Isaac Sim, Webots, PyBullet, MuJoCo)
Mechanical Components of Robotic Arms
Mechanical Design of Robot Joints and Frames
Soft Robotics: Materials and Actuation
Robot Joints, Materials, and Longevity
Soft Robotics: Materials and Actuation
Mechanical Design: Lightweight vs Stiffness
Thermal Management for Compact Robots
Environmental Protection: IP Ratings, Sealing, and EMC/EMI
Wiring Harnesses & Connectors for Robots
Lightweight Structural Materials in Robot Design
Joint and Linkage Design for Precision Motion
Structural Vibration Damping in Lightweight Robots
Lightweight Alloys and Composites for Robot Frames
Joint Design and Bearing Selection for High Precision
Modular Robot Structures: Designing for Scalability and Repairability
Behavior Trees & State Machines (task orchestration)
End Effectors: The Hands of Robots
End Effectors: Choosing the Right Tool
End Effectors: Designing Robot Hands and Tools
Robot Grippers: Design and Selection
End Effectors for Logistics and E-commerce
End Effectors and Tool Changers: Designing for Quick Re-Tooling
Designing Custom End Effectors for Complex Tasks
Tool Changers and Quick-Swap Systems for Robotics
Soft Grippers: Safe Interaction for Fragile Objects
Vacuum and Magnetic End Effectors: Industrial Applications
Adaptive Grippers and AI-Controlled Manipulation
Robot Middleware (communication frameworks, message protocols)
Robot Computing Hardware
Cloud Robotics and Edge Computing
Computing Hardware for Edge AI Robots
AI Hardware Acceleration for Robotics
Embedded GPUs for Edge Robotics
Edge AI Deployment: Quantization and Pruning
Embedded Computing Boards for Robotics
Ruggedizing Compute for the Edge: GPUs, IPCs, SBCs
Time-Sensitive Networking (TSN) and Deterministic Ethernet
Embedded Computing for Real-Time Robotics
Edge AI Hardware: GPUs, FPGAs, and NPUs
FPGA-Based Real-Time Vision Processing for Robots
Real-Time Computing on Edge Devices for Robotics
GPU Acceleration in Robotics Vision and Simulation
FPGA Acceleration for Low-Latency Control Loops